Setting the Table
The Transforming Power of Hospitality in Business
Hospitality, not just service, is the real competitive edge.
Meyer chronicles his rise from a single Manhattan restaurant to a hospitality empire, sharing the philosophy of enlightened hospitality behind it. He argues that putting employees first, then guests, community, suppliers, and investors creates the emotional loyalty that drives lasting business success.
Founders compete on product and price while underrating how customers feel when they are served. Meyer's framework shows how genuine hospitality builds the kind of loyalty and word of mouth no marketing budget can buy.
